Date | Name | Activity | Value |
---|---|---|---|
Aug 21, 2025 | xxxxxxxxxxxxx | $3943080 | |
Jun 09, 2025 | xxxxxxxxxxxxx | $190698 | |
Jun 09, 2025 | xxxxxxxxxxxxx | $20375201 | |
Mar 10, 2025 | xxxxxxxxxxxxx | $585000 |
Date | Firm | Activity | Value |
---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$14282 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$306374 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$14312259 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$20156921 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
4,888,168 | Insider | 9.00% | 528,019,907 | |
4,407,833 | Institution | 8.11% | 476,134,121 | |
4,258,515 | Institution | 7.84% | 460,004,790 | |
4,141,530 | Institution | 7.62% | 447,368,071 | |
3,413,918 | Institution | 6.28% | 368,771,422 | |
1,503,762 | Institution | 2.77% | 162,436,371 | |
1,412,000 | Institution | 2.60% | 152,524,240 | |
1,267,599 | Institution | 2.33% | 136,926,044 | |
1,061,180 | Insider | 1.95% | 114,628,664 | |
1,037,130 | Institution | 1.91% | 112,030,783 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
4,258,515 | Institution | 7.84% | 460,004,790 | |
1,503,762 | Institution | 2.77% | 162,436,371 | |
1,412,000 | Institution | 2.60% | 152,524,240 | |
1,267,599 | Institution | 2.33% | 136,926,044 | |
1,037,130 | Institution | 1.91% | 112,030,783 | |
846,867 | Institution | 1.56% | 91,478,573 | |
514,854 | Institution | 0.95% | 55,614,529 | |
511,832 | Institution | 0.94% | 55,288,093 | |
498,500 | Institution | 0.92% | 53,847,970 | |
445,766 | Institution | 0.82% | 48,151,643 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
1,665,564 | Institution | 3.07% | 144,487,677 | |
1,571,182 | Institution | 2.89% | 177,779,243 | |
1,526,025 | Institution | 2.81% | 164,841,221 | |
1,220,125 | Institution | 2.25% | 138,057,144 | |
483,635 | Institution | 0.89% | 54,723,300 | |
392,813 | Institution | 0.72% | 44,446,791 | |
358,101 | Institution | 0.66% | 38,682,070 | |
340,978 | Institution | 0.63% | 38,581,661 | |
245,226 | Institution | 0.45% | 26,288,227 | |
230,198 | Institution | 0.42% | 24,677,226 |